The first Albion match this year ended in a win for Plumpton, 2092 to 1804.
The weather was pretty horrible, with heavy showers on and off from the start and after 6 dozen, we decided to abandon the match, because of prolonged heavy rain and rumbles of thunder. The adjustments for compound and barebow were reduced to -66 and +120, as only 6 of the 9 dozen arrows were shot and the final team scores were as follows :-
Plumpton -
Alan 550 (C), Martin 524 (C), Dave 512 (C), Steve 506 (R)
Ditchling –
John 471 (BB), Bob 463 (R), Ben 453 (R), Taff 417 (R)
